#coding: utf-8
from BaseHTTPServer import BaseHTTPRequestHandler
from StringIO import StringIO
class HTTPRequest(BaseHTTPRequestHandler):
def __init__(self, request_text):
self.rfile = StringIO(request_text)
self.raw_requestline = self.rfile.readline()
self.error_code = self.error_message = None
self.parse_request()
def send_error(self, code, message):
self.error_code = code
self.error_message = message
def __str__(self):
if self.error_code: return "<error:%d, %s>" % (self.error_code, self.error_message)
return "<%s: %s>" % (self.command, self.path) + "\n".join(["-> %s:%s" % (x[0], x[1]) for x in self.headers.items()])
__repr__ = __str__
class HTTPResponse(HTTPRequest):
def parse_request(self):
"""Parse a request (internal).
The request should be stored in self.raw_requestline; the results
are in self.command, self.path, self.request_version and
self.headers.
Return True for success, False for failure; on failure, an
error is sent back.
"""
self.command = None # set in case of error on the first line
self.request_version = version = self.default_request_version
self.close_connection = 1
requestline = self.raw_requestline
requestline = requestline.rstrip('\r\n')
self.requestline = requestline
words = requestline.split(' ', 2)
# import ipdb; ipdb.set_trace()
if len(words) == 3:
version, code, code_str = words
code = int(code)
if version[:5] != 'HTTP/':
self.send_error(400, "Bad request version (%r)" % version)
return False
try:
base_version_number = version.split('/', 1)[1]
version_number = base_version_number.split(".")
# RFC 2145 section 3.1 says there can be only one "." and
# - major and minor numbers MUST be treated as
# separate integers;
# - HTTP/2.4 is a lower version than HTTP/2.13, which in
# turn is lower than HTTP/12.3;
# - Leading zeros MUST be ignored by recipients.
if len(version_number) != 2:
raise ValueError
version_number = int(version_number[0]), int(version_number[1])
except (ValueError, IndexError):
self.send_error(400, "Bad response version (%r)" % version)
return False
if version_number >= (1, 1) and self.protocol_version >= "HTTP/1.1":
self.close_connection = 0
if version_number >= (2, 0):
self.send_error(505,
"Invalid HTTP Version (%s)" % base_version_number)
return False
else:
self.send_error(400, "Bad response syntax (%r)" % requestline)
return False
self.response_version, self.response_code, self.response_code_str = version, code, code_str
# Examine the headers and look for a Connection directive
self.headers = self.MessageClass(self.rfile, 0)
conntype = self.headers.get('Connection', "")
if conntype.lower() == 'close':
self.close_connection = 1
elif (conntype.lower() == 'keep-alive' and
self.protocol_version >= "HTTP/1.1"):
self.close_connection = 0
return True
def __str__(self):
if self.error_code: return "<error:%d, %s>" % (self.error_code, self.error_message)
return "<%d: %s>" % (self.response_code, self.response_code_str) + "\n".join(["<- %s:%s" % (x[0], x[1]) for x in self.headers.items()])
__repr__ = __str__
